私は別のjarのクラスにリンクしようとする簡単なテストmavenプロジェクト(Eclipse Neon上)を持っています。Maven:依存関係でパッケージを検出できません
プロジェクトの構造は、次の画像に表示されます。
Log4jManagerは、「サードパーティ」瓶のプロジェクトです。 Log4jExは、それを使用しようとするクライアントです。
aaaa.javaでは、インポートがLog4jManagerのパッケージの正しいパスを指していることがあります。しかし、彼らはコンパイルに失敗します。
あなたがしてください助けることができます:
これはPOMファイルですか?友人の提案に続き
、私はInteliJをインストールし、同じプロジェクトを作成しました:
はUPDATE
タル
、ありがとうございます。 - とすべてが正常になりますだから、ただ、「クリーンプロジェクト」(>クリーンプロジェクト]メニュー)
Log4jをクラスパスに追加してみます。 http://stackoverflow.com/questions/3280353/how-to-import-a-jar-in-eclipse – Unknown